Petitioner having moved for an extension of time to file and serve a brief on this CPLR article 78 proceeding transferred to this Court by an order of the Supreme Court entered in the Office of the Clerk of the County of Erie on January 26, 2017,

Now, upon reading and filing the affidavit of Edward J. Markarian, Esq., and Jesslyn A. Holbrook, Esq., sworn to March 13, 2017, and the notice of motion with proof of service thereof, and due deliberation having been had thereon,

It is hereby ORDERED that the motion is granted on the condition that petitioner's brief is filed and served on or before May 1, 2017, and the Clerk is directed to accept the brief for filing, and

It is further ORDERED that respondent's brief shall be filed and served on or before June 5, 2017, and the Clerk is directed to accept the brief for filing.
